 railroad ties

I tried using untreated ties, called cull ties because they were rejected by the RR prior to treating for some flaw. They were mostly red oak, some white oak. I soaked each of 55 in a copper-based preservative solution. It may have slowed down the decay process by a few years, but now after 10 years, I had to tear up what was left of them.
A contractor used creosoted timbers from a dismantled railway bridge for a retaining wall on my driveway 15 years ago. It looks like it will last for 50 years.
